I have been experiencing this too, on a 4-core Xeon with hyperthreading.
Basically, what happens is that after a suspend/resume cycle or a
hibernate/thaw cycle, a single process cannot span more than TWO cores.
Here's a nice picture:
http://jonathan.protzenko.free.fr/beforesuspend.png
This is a build (make -j 16) of Mozilla Thunderbird. The build is highly
parallel. The build dir was clean. All 8 logical cores are used.
http://jonathan.protzenko.free.fr/aftersuspend.png
Exact same build, after suspend. I did run make clean. Please note that
only two cores are 100% busy and the other five do strictly nothing. The
scheduler seems to be dead.
